Minimizing Input Lag

To minimize input lag on your refurbished monitor, it's crucial to ensure a direct and stable connection between the monitor and your device. Using a high-quality HDMI or DisplayPort cable can significantly reduce input lag and provide a smoother gaming or viewing experience. Additionally, make sure to properly configure your monitor's settings to match the output resolution and refresh rate of your device to avoid any unnecessary delays in processing input signals.

Another effective way to reduce input lag is by enabling the "Game Mode" or "Low Input Lag" feature on your monitor, if available. These settings prioritize faster response times and minimize processing delays, resulting in a more responsive display during fast-paced activities. By optimizing these settings and maintaining a strong connection, you can enjoy a more seamless and lag-free experience on your refurbished monitor.

Optimizing Response Time

To optimize the response time of your refurbished monitor, it is crucial to adjust the settings to achieve the best performance. Start by accessing the monitor's menu and locating the response time option. Lowering the response time can significantly reduce motion blur, resulting in a smoother and more seamless viewing experience during fast-paced activities such as gaming or watching action-packed movies.

Additionally, make sure to enable any specific gaming or motion enhancement features that your monitor may offer. These features are designed to further reduce ghosting and blur, providing sharper image quality and better overall responsiveness. Experiment with different settings to find the ideal balance between response time and image quality that suits your preference and enhances your viewing experience with the refurbished monitor.

Enhancing Viewing Angles

When optimizing the viewing angles of your refurbished monitor, it is crucial to consider the type of panel technology it uses. For example, In-Plane Switching (IPS) panels are known for their superior color accuracy and wider viewing angles compared to Twisted Nematic (TN) panels. By choosing a monitor with IPS technology, you can ensure that colors remain consistent and vivid even when viewed from different angles.

Another aspect to enhance viewing angles is to adjust the monitor's position and tilt to align it with your eye level. This simple adjustment can significantly improve the viewing experience by reducing color distortion and maintaining image clarity regardless of your viewing position. Additionally, be mindful of ambient lighting conditions as glare and reflections can also impact the perceived image quality from different angles. By minimizing sources of glare and positioning the monitor strategically, you can optimize the viewing angles for a more enjoyable visual experience.

Panel Technology and Viewing Angles

When considering a refurbished monitor, it is crucial to pay attention to the panel technology and viewing angles to ensure optimal performance and usability. Panel technology refers to the type of display used in the monitor, such as IPS (In-Plane Switching), TN (Twisted Nematic), or VA (Vertical Alignment). Each type offers different advantages and disadvantages, impacting factors like color accuracy, response times, and viewing angles.

Viewing angles are particularly important when it comes to the overall user experience with a monitor. Wide viewing angles ensure that colors and details remain consistent even when viewed from different perspectives. IPS panels are known for their excellent viewing angles, making them a popular choice for tasks that require accurate color representation, such as graphic design and photo editing. Understanding the panel technology and viewing angles of your refurbished monitor can help you make an informed decision and optimize your viewing experience.

Extending Lifespan of Panel

To ensure the longevity of your refurbished monitor's panel, proper care and maintenance are crucial. One effective way to extend the lifespan of the panel is to avoid exposing it to extreme temperatures. Excessive heat or cold can significantly affect the performance and overall lifespan of the panel, so it is important to keep the monitor in a well-ventilated area with stable temperatures.

Additionally, regular cleaning of the panel can help prevent dust and debris from accumulating, which can impact the display quality over time. Use a soft, lint-free cloth to gently wipe the screen, avoiding harsh chemicals that could potentially damage the panel. By incorporating these simple practices into your monitor maintenance routine, you can enjoy a longer lifespan for your refurbished monitor's panel.

Maintaining Panel Health

To ensure the longevity of your monitor's panel, it's crucial to adopt a regular maintenance routine. Start by gently wiping the surface of the panel with a soft microfiber cloth to remove dust and smudges. Avoid using harsh chemicals or abrasive materials that could potentially damage the screen. Additionally, make sure to power off the monitor before cleaning to prevent any electrical mishaps.

Another important aspect of maintaining panel health is to adjust the brightness and contrast settings appropriately. Excessive brightness can lead to accelerated wear and tear on the panel, while incorrect contrast settings may result in distorted colors and reduced clarity. By fine-tuning these settings to suit your viewing preferences and ambient lighting conditions, you can help preserve the overall health and performance of your monitor's panel.
